Highly addictive stir-fried chicken and peanuts, complex sauce of salty, sweet, sour.
1 lb | Maple Leaf Prime Naturally® Portions™: Boneless Skinless Chicken Breast cut into 1-inch cubes |
2 tbsp | soy sauce |
2 tsp | cornstarch |
1 tsp | hoisin sauce |
2 tsp | sugar |
2 tbsp | vegetable oil |
3 | scallions thinly sliced separate the white from the green |
2 | garlic cloves minced |
1 tsp | minced fresh ginger |
1/4 cup | green pepper sliced |
1/4 cup | unsalted dry-roasted peanuts |
1- Mix the chicken with 1-tablespoon soy sauce and 1-tablespoon cornstarch in a bowl until the cornstarch dissolved.
2- Mix the hoisin sauce, sugar, 1-tablespoon soy sauce, and 1-tablespoon cornstarch in another bowl until the cornstarch and sugar dissolved.
3- Heat a large skillet over high heat add the oil and wait until it is hot, add the chicken and stir-fry until no longer pink for 3 minutes.
4- Add the garlic, white scallions, green pepper and ginger, stir-fry for about 1 minute.
5- Finally pour the sauce mix and roasted peanuts, stir and cook for another 2 minutes, transfer to a serving plate, sprinkle the scallion greens on top, and serve.
